Transaction 33c4960d3118d2960e8a55ec49d4e0efaffc9910862fa12010bddc27592e7377
1 Input
2 Outputs
- 33c4960d3118d2960e8a55ec49d4e0efaffc9910862fa12010bddc27592e7377:0
- 33c4960d3118d2960e8a55ec49d4e0efaffc9910862fa12010bddc27592e7377:1
value 117846
address 1DWogPd7bN8o9ozaWHyU9EvpCTpB43yNHC
value 135250
address 1DhFKNe64hcuWDJGF2VkL18bCzqN976Xra